General Electric (GE) Common Equity (2009 - 2026)

General Electric (GE) posted Common Equity of $17.9 billion for Q2 2026, down 22.81% sequentially from $23.1 billion in Q1 2026, and down 7.64% YoY from $19.3 billion in Q2 2025.
